Hi there
I have a VVX 300 version 5.2.0.8330
The phone keeps getting random calls from these numbers
Sip:6207@232.252.***.***
Sip:5500@232.252.***.***
Sip:4400@232.252.***.***
Sip:550@232.252.***.***
Sip:660@232.252.***.***
I obscured the last 6 digits because it is out own external ip address
When i try to pick up the call nothing happens and hanging up doesnt do anything either, have to wait it out for the call to dissappear
Anything i can do to prevent or fix this?

Hello Simon24,
I have replied with the above FAQ post as this will address you issue and only allow INVITES on the phones to be processed if they come from the hostname or IP address that your phone is registered to.
This works for other users and you simply import the example .cfg file via your Web Browser. There is no option to activate this via the Web Browser or the FAQ would show this.
